Hershey is finally in heat and is going to Philly to meet SImon - her boyfriend. I expect grandpuppies by the end of October if all goes well.
She is going that far because she is a rare breed (Portuguese Water Dog) and we have to be careful of the breeding line because it's a very small gene pool.
